- 博客(20)
- 资源 (7)
- 收藏
- 关注
原创 python算法指南:完美平方错误修改
#完美平方#给定一个正整数n,找到若干个完全平方数(例如:1,4,9,...),使得他们的平方和等于n,完全平方数的个数最少class Solution: def numSquares(self,n): while n % 4 == 0: n //= 4 if n % 8 == 7: return 4 for i in range(n+1): temp = i * i
2020-09-29 09:13:26 166
原创 Hierarchical Clustering with Hard-batch Triplet Loss for Person Re-identification简单的阅读理解
Hierarchical Clustering with Hard-batch Triplet Loss for Person Re-identification摘要} 提出了分层聚类与硬批三联点损失相结合的伪标签聚类方法,关键思想是通过层次聚类,充分利用目标数据集中样本间的相似性,通过硬批处理的三合点损失来降低硬例的影响,产生高质量的伪标签和dimprove模型性能} 具体来说:(1)使用层次聚类生成伪标签(2)在每次迭代中使用PK采样生成新的数据集进行训练(3)在每次迭代中进行硬批三个一组丢失的训
2020-09-27 16:54:58 633
原创 Real-world Person Re-Identification via Degradation Invariance Learning简单阅读整理
Real-world Person Re-Identification via Degradation Invariance Learning简单阅读整理
2020-09-27 16:52:34 537
原创 Style Normalization and Restitution for Generalizable Person Re-identification简单阅读整理
Style Normalization and Restitution for Generalizable Person Re-identification简单阅读整理
2020-09-27 16:50:48 469
原创 Smoothing Adversarial Domain Attack and p-Memory Reconsolidation for Cross-Domain简单阅读整理
Smoothing Adversarial Domain Attack and p-Memory Reconsolidation for Cross-Domain简单阅读整理
2020-09-27 16:49:00 372
原创 python文本处理常用函数整理
python文本处理常用函数整理string,文本处理工具str类textwrap:格式化文本段落re:正则表达式difflib:比较序列string,文本处理工具str类textwrap:格式化文本段落re:正则表达式difflib:比较序列
2020-09-27 10:07:13 1489
原创 pytorch feat.renorm(2, 0, 1e-5).mul(1e5)解释
在学习pytorch,针对某个具体方向去读代码时,遇到了一些关于pytorch函数上面的问题,通过查阅相关资料得知关于feat.renorm(2, 0, 1e-5).mul(1e5)的作用,就相当于是对feat进行归一化的处理。其中前两个2,0是代表在第0维度对feat进行L2范数操作得到归一化结果。1e-5是代表maxnorm ,将大于1e-5的乘以1e5,使得最终归一化到0到1之间。简单例子如下所示:import torchfeat = torch.Tensor([[1,2,3],[4,5,6],
2020-09-23 20:36:22 958
原创 python:对二叉树进行镜像翻转完整程序,包括数组转二叉树,以及层序遍历输出二叉树
class TreeNode: def __init__(self): self.val = None self.left = None self.right = Nonedef invertTree(root): if not root: return None root.left,root.right=invertTree(root.right),invertTree(root.left) retu
2020-09-16 16:20:29 212
原创 程序员笔试之360公司2021技术综合类 编程题收集整理(十三)
1.验证密码复杂性验证密码复杂性是网站在用户输入初始密码后需要进行的一步操作。现在,小A的网站需要验证密码的复杂性,小A对一个足够复杂的密码拥有如下要求:1.要有数字2.要有大写字母3.要有小写字母4.要有特殊字符5.长度不得小于8现在给你密码,请你判断这个密码是否足够复杂输入描述:输入包含多组数据,对于每组数据,包含一个字符串S.输出描述:如果密码足够复杂,输出OK,否则输出Irregular password.请注意输出的大小写示例输入:12_Aaqq12Password12
2020-09-14 10:25:03 558 1
原创 程序员笔试之大翼云2021技术类 编程题收集整理(十二)
1.读入一个自然数N,求按从小到大的顺序的第N个丑数并输出,注:把只包含因子2,3和5的数称作丑数(Ugly Number)。例如6,8都是丑数,但是14不是,因为它包含因子7.习惯上我们把1当作是第一个丑数。输入描述:输入包括一个整数N(1<=N<=1500)输出描述:每输入一个测试数据,就输出第N个丑数示例输入:3示例输出:32.设a,b,c,d均是0到9之间的数字,abcd,bcda是两个四位数字,且有:abcd+bcda=8888.求满足条件的所有a,b,c,d的值。
2020-09-14 09:53:09 303
原创 程序员笔试之乐信2021后台开发工程师 选择题收集整理(十四)
1.下面哪些方式可以让一个短连接变成一个长连接(不定项)A.发送RST指令B.发送FIN指令C.Http协议中header中加入 --Connection:keep-aliveD.定时发送心跳包2.操作系统具有进程管理,存储管理,文件管理和设备管理的功能,在以下有关的描述中,哪些正确的(不定项)A.进程管理主要是对程序进行管理B.设备管理是指计算机系统中除了CPU和内存以外的所有输入,输出设备的管理C.文件管理可以有效的支持对文件的操作,解决文件共享,保密和保护问题D.存储管理主要是管理内
2020-09-11 10:58:45 679
原创 Relation-Aware Global Attention for Person Re-identification论文阅读整理
Relation-Aware Global Attention for Person Re-identification论文阅读整理AbstractIntroductionRelation-Aware Global AttentionFormulation and Main IdeaSpatial Relation-Aware Global AttentionAbstract这是2020年CVPR行人重识别领域的一篇文章,提出了一个有效的关系感知全局注意(RGA)模块,它捕获全局结构信息,以更好地进行注
2020-09-10 16:37:09 2915
原创 Online Joint Multi-Metric Adaptation from Frequent Sharing-Subset Mining阅读整理
Online Joint Multi-Metric Adaptation from Frequent Sharing-Subset Mining for Person Re-Identification是2020CVPR行人重识别领域的一篇文章。行人重识别作为一个实例级的一个识别问题,在计算机视觉领域仍然是一个具有挑战性的问题。许多P-RID的工作旨在从离线的训练数据中学习忠实的和有区别的特征或者指标,并直接将它们用于看不见的在线测试数据。然而,由于训练数据和测试数据之间存在严重的数据转换问题,它们的性能在
2020-09-08 14:13:19 477 1
原创 程序员笔试之腾讯2021校园招聘后台&综合 编程题收集整理(十一)
1.小Q给你两个降序排序好的链表,小Q希望你能求出两个链表的公共部分。公共部分是指在两个链表中均出现过的子序列。注:需要自己处理输入输出,请根据题意自己定义,链表节点,相关函数输入描述:输入的第一行为第一个链表的长度n.第二行为第一个链表的每个节点值val.第三行为第二个链表的长度m.第四行为第二个链表的每个节点值va.1<=n,m<=1000000,−109<=val<=109-10^9<=val<=10^9−109<=val<=109输出描
2020-09-07 14:28:39 605
原创 Inter-Task Association Critic for Cross-Resolution Person Re-Identification论文整理理解
Inter-Task Association Critic for Cross-Resolution Person Re-Identification论文整理理解Abstract
2020-09-05 14:58:12 584
原创 程序员笔试之海康威视2021应用软件开发工程师C/C++单选题收集整理(十二)
1.以下关于进程和线程的描述错误的是()A.每个线程拥有自己的堆栈和局部变量B.线程是程序执行的最小单位C.进程切换比线程切换的开销更小D.进程有独立的地址空间,而线程没有2.下列哪个定义是非法的()A.int ival=1.01B.const int &rval3=1C.int &rval2=ivalD.int &rvall=1.03.以下叙述中正确的是()A.在一个程序中,允许使用任意数量的#include命令行B.虽然包含文件被修改了,包含该文件的源程序
2020-09-02 10:08:08 3109
opencv实现四个视频同时的运动目标的追踪,并显示处运动轨迹,同时进行屏幕的录制,向本地服务器上传视频
2018-03-16
江南大学计算机组成原理期末设计,使用VHDL编写的一个可以运行的CPU,包括bit文件
2018-03-08
matlab算法集合打包
2017-12-06
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人